A hospital management system (HMS) is integrated software that automates every clinical, financial and administrative workflow in a hospital or clinic, patient registration, EMR, OPD, IPD, OT, pharmacy, lab, radiology, billing, insurance claims, HR and reporting. A modern HMS replaces paper records, disconnected tools and Excel spreadsheets with a single, real-time, role-based system.
How to choose a hospital management system in Saudi Arabia or UAE?
Step 1: Define your baseline, list current systems, identify gaps, run a discovery workshop with clinical, financial, IT and admin teams. Step 2: Confirm regulatory fit, NPHIES (KSA), NABIDH (Dubai), MALAFFI (Abu Dhabi), Riayati. Step 3: Verify integrations, HL7, FHIR, ASTM, DICOM. Step 4: Reference-check 2–3 hospitals of similar size and specialty. Step 5: Pilot with one department for 30 days before full rollout.

Is the HMS NPHIES Phase 1 and Phase 2 compliant?
Yes. NPHIES integrated for eligibility verification (Discovery, Validation, Benefits via TAAMEEN), real-time e-claims submission, and SEHEYA unified EMR access. Full Phase 2 support.
Is it NABIDH and MALAFFI compliant for the UAE?
Yes. Full integration with NABIDH (Dubai Health Authority) and MALAFFI (Abu Dhabi Department of Health) for the federally-mandated unified patient record. Riayati federal compliance also supported.
Can it integrate with our lab analyzers and radiology modalities?
Yes. HL7 v2.5, FHIR, ASTM and DICOM, natively integrated with Roche, Sysmex, Mindray analyzers; modality worklist for CT, MRI, ultrasound, X-ray; PACS storage included.
How is patient data secured?
End-to-end TLS 1.3 in transit, AES-256 at rest, role-based access by role / specialty / department, audit log of every record access. Compliant with HIPAA (US), GDPR (EU), Saudi PDPL, and UAE data protection law.
